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ers

On July 15, 2009, Burger King Holdings, Inc. (the “Company”) announced the appointment of Mr. Kevin Higgins as President of its Europe, Middle East & Africa (EMEA) region, effective August 17, 2009. Mr. Higgins succeeds Mr. Peter Robinson who has served as President of the Company’s EMEA region since October 1, 2006 and is leaving the Company in October 2009 after completion of his three year commitment to the Company.

 

Item 5.05 Amendments to the Registrant’s Code of Ethics, or Waiver of a Provision of the Code of Ethics.

On July 15, 2009, the Company revised the Code of Business Ethics and Conduct (the “Code of Conduct”) posted on its website at http://investor.bk.com/phoenix.zhtml?c=87140&p=irol-govhighlights. The Company also posted its new Code of Conduct on the website. The Code of Conduct was revised (i) to remove references to the Company’s prior business strategy and incorporate the Company’s current business strategy; (ii) to address Company investigations, specifically that employees must cooperate with any internal investigation or inquiry undertaken by the Company; and (iii) for overall style and clarity. The Code of Conduct applies to all employees of the Company, including the Company’s principal executive officer, principal financial officer, principal accounting officer and all other executive officers.
